A&E has announced new “Biography” specials offering viewers a backstage pass to the celebrated careers of some of hard rock’s greatest legends – Bret Michaels, Twisted Sister‘s Dee Snider, Alice Cooper, Sammy Hagar, and Sebastian Bach.

Produced by Banger Films in association with A+E Factual Studios, the specials will feature exclusive interviews with the artists and those closest to them.

Beginning June 16 at 9pm ET, the nostalgia inducing specials will go behind-the-scenes to the artists’ journeys to fame, legendary careers, and iconic music that defined the genre then and now.

“Biography: Bret Michaels” kicks off the series, chronicling how a boy from small-town Pennsylvania and Type-1 Diabetic became a pop culture icon, philanthropist, and one of the most recognizable faces in America.

Premiering June 23 at 9 pm ET, “Biography: Dee Snider” shares the untold story of how Snider went from a high school choir boy to one of the most recognized faces in hard rock.

Premiering June 23 at 10 pm ET, “Biography: Alice Cooper” explores the highs and lows of an incredible journey and genre defining artist. Shock rock, hard rock, amazing rock – Alice Cooper and his pioneering group have been described as the founders of it all.

Premiering June 30 at 9 pm ET, “Biography: Sammy Hagar” traces Hagar’s path to fame, beginning as a poverty-stricken child, to the lead singer of the band Montrose, to launching a successful solo career, and ultimately joining Van Halen.

Premiering June 30 at 10 pm ET, “Biography: Sebastian Bach” outlines how a small-town kid from Canada became the ultimate bad boy of hard rock.

All specials will be available on demand and to stream on the A&E App and aetv.com
